  • They are made of crude bronze and are extremely old, likely being from the Third Age. They were used by the Zarosians of Senntisten. Often, players new to the Varrock museum misinterpret the arrowheads to be arrowtips, which members may use in Fletching. However, when they try to connect the arrowheads with headless arrows, nothing interesting happens.
